Strategies

A Strategy defines rules for automatically generating work orders. Instead of manually creating work orders every time maintenance is due, you configure a Strategy and WAKU Care handles the scheduling for you.

  • Never miss maintenance — Work orders are created automatically based on your rules
  • Reduce manual effort — No need to remember or manually schedule recurring work
  • Consistent scheduling — Intervals and triggers are applied uniformly across devices
  • Data-driven maintenance — Usage-based and anomaly-based strategies react to actual device conditions

A Strategy connects three things:

  1. Devices — Which devices this strategy applies to
  2. Schedule or trigger — When work orders should be created
  3. Work Template — What tasks should be included in the generated work orders

When the schedule or trigger conditions are met, WAKU Care automatically creates a work order for the relevant devices, pre-loaded with tasks from the specified Work Template.

Each strategy includes:

  • Title and description — What this strategy covers
  • Deployment — Which site this strategy applies to
  • Devices — The specific devices covered
  • Duration — Expected duration for the generated work orders
  • Assignee — Who should be assigned to generated work orders
  • Tags — Maintenance Tags applied to generated work orders
  • Active/Inactive — Toggle whether the strategy is currently generating work orders
  • Strategy Types — Scheduled, usage-based, and anomaly-based strategies
